Local Schools Near Mascotte Hills, Mascotte, 34753

Mascotte Hills is a community located in Mascotte, FL, within the 34753 ZIP code. Mascotte is a small city in Lake County, Florida, and falls under the Lake County School District.     Additional Notes on School Ratings and Selection

    • Ratings Context: Ratings from GreatSchools.org (or similar platforms like Niche.com) are based on metrics such as standardized test scores, student growth, equity, and parent feedback. A rating of 5/10 is considered average, while below 5 may indicate challenges in academic performance or resources. Always supplement ratings with school visits or conversations with current parents/students.
    • Zoning Verification: School assignments can depend on exact addresses within Mascotte Hills. Use the Lake County School District’s school locator tool (available on their website) or call the district office at (352) 253-6500 to confirm zoning for your specific address.
    • Charter and Magnet Options: Beyond Mascotte Charter School, Lake County has other charter and magnet programs that may be accessible via application or lottery, though they might be farther away (e.g., in Clermont or Leesburg).
